    Common name Enchanter’s nightshade
    Latin name Circaea lutetiana
    Areas affected Woodland beds and borders in shade


     Weed with spreading stolons

    make sure you get out all the little white  fleshy roots, and whatever you do, don't let it flower and seed. Dont be fooled by those pretty little flowers.
